Euzophera albicostalis is a species of snout moth in the genus Euzophera . It was described by George Hampson in 1903. It is found in Russia, [1] India and Iran.
The wingspan is about 26 mm. The forewings are pale brown, irrorated (sprinkled) with fuscous. The hindwings are pale brown, tinged with fuscous towards the costa. [2]
